def ten_crop(img: numpy.ndarray, size: List[int], vertical_flip: bool = False) -> List[numpy.ndarray]: """Generate ten cropped images from the given image. Crop the given image into four corners and the central crop plus the flipped version of these (horizontal flipping is used by default). Args: img (numpy.ndarray): Image to be cropped. size (sequence or int): Desired output size of the crop. If size is an int instead of sequence like (h, w), a square crop (size, size) is made. If provided a sequence of length 1, it will be interpreted as (size[0], size[0]). vertical_flip (bool): Use vertical flipping instead of horizontal Returns: tuple: tuple (tl, tr, bl, br, center, tl_flip, tr_flip, bl_flip, br_flip, center_flip) Corresponding top left, top right, bottom left, bottom right and center crop and same for the flipped image. """ first_five = five_crop(img, size) if vertical_flip: img = F.vflip(img) else: img = F.hflip(img) second_five = five_crop(img, size) return first_five + second_five
